Another wowing moment for the mummy

by Penny on June 15, 2009



Last night when we got home we realised that we forgot to pick up something from the store. Instead of using the car with the baby car seat installed in it, we decided to just take the other car without the seat because it was easier to get it out. It was going to be a very short ride to the shops within the neighbourhood, so we thought it’d be okay for Ryan to sit with me in the backseat.

When I explained to him that he needs to sit there and not climb about because it is dangerous, he listened and agreed. In fact, he was such a great boy that the entire time he did remain seated until I told him he can get up and look out the window when the car stopped.

But in that short period of time, Ryan wowed me over twice. The first was right after I explained to him that he needed to remain seated at all times. After he agreed to it, he told me that he wanted to put on the seat belt. He pulled it over his little body and I helped him buckle it in. I was quite impressed that he voluntarily wanted to put on the safety belt because whenever he’s in his own car seat, he doesn’t like the safety belt!

I was already beaming with pride at my little son when he wowed me another time as I finished buckling him in. He said “Wear seat belt, otherwise the bad man catch boy boy”. What wowed me in his sentence was the word “otherwise”. We don’t use that word often with him, and definitely didn’t teach him to say it. We found out later that some weeks back his paternal grandma had used that word when he was staying over, so he must’ve picked it up from her.

I’m really very wowed by his vocabs these days. I know this is typical of a first time mother, but I do savour all these wowing moments.
